Phone number 03 9274 9412 has been reported as a scam caller attempting to sell National Broadband Network services. If you receive a call from this number, avoid engaging and block it to stay safe.

Identifying the Risks Associated with 03 9274 9412

The phone number 03 9274 9412 / 0392749412 has raised numerous red flags among users, being classified unequivocally as a scam caller. Reports indicate that this number is linked to unsolicited attempts to sell National Broadband Network (NBN) services, often employing deceptive tactics to lure unsuspecting victims.

How to Handle Calls from 03 9274 9412

If you receive a call from 03 9274 9412 / 0392749412, here are some recommended steps to protect yourself:

  • Do Not Engage: If you suspect a call is from a scammer, it is best to hang up immediately.
  • Block the Number: Prevent future communication by blocking this number on your phone.
  • Report the Incident: Consider notifying your telecommunications provider or the relevant authorities about the scam attempt.
